Userview Form is one of Userview Builder's basic elements and a very important one. It allows one to integrate forms into the Userview, allowing users to interact with each other via forms.

Field Name for URL Redirect Value Passover

Defines on which form field 's value to will be used as part of the redirection URL . (Ee.g., "id")

Field Value Passover Method

Defines on how to construct the redirect URL . Selections available:- will be constructed. Available options:

  • Append to URL (Ee.g., "http://www.example.com/page/123" where "123" is the value of the field defined in "Field Name for URL Redirect Value Passover")
  • As URL Request Parameter (Ee.g., "http://www.example.com/?page=123")

Request Parameter Name

If "As URL Request Parameter" is chosen as the "Field Value Passover Method", the request parameter name must be defined in this field . (Ee.g., "page").
